Head of Governance, Compliance and Risk job summary
At Orion Education Trust, our mission is:
To create welcoming and open schools for the local community, where every person thrives, makes excellent progress and succeeds.
We are guided by our values of Trust, Kindness and Endeavour. These values shape how we lead, how we support, and how we serve our schools and communities across Bromley and Kent.
Strong governance, compliance, and risk management underpin this mission — ensuring that every decision we make is ethical, transparent, and aligned with the best interests of the children and communities we serve.
Through the Orion Community Impact Charity, we extend this commitment beyond our schools, supporting programmes that strengthen inclusion, wellbeing, and opportunity.
The postholder will act as Company Secretary and Data Protection Officer (DPO) for the Trust, ensuring all statutory, legal, and regulatory requirements are fully met. They will oversee the Trust’s complaints process, ensuring consistency, fairness, and transparency, and will also support governance across the Orion Community Impact Charity.
Reporting directly to the Chief Executive, the postholder will be a key source of assurance and professional advice to Trustees, Members, and senior leaders, ensuring that Orion’s governance reflects the highest standards of accountability and integrity.
